Experts are baffled by structures under Pacific that shouldn’t exist

Scientists at ETH Zurich and the California Institute of Technology (Caltech) have found massive structures deep beneath the Pacific waters that ‘shouldn’t exist’.

Go to Source
Author: Jonathan Chadwick